Transaction 691b7c22faf441aa8244cc8d959bd30dc2c90d037ae7ea8210799b74d7a37285
1 Input
1 Output
-
691b7c22faf441aa8244cc8d959bd30dc2c90d037ae7ea8210799b74d7a37285:0
- value
- 1759350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67fa4bfd2fc213f8e99bd57da2deb8138f254804 OP_EQUAL
- address
- 3BAoNEMYmbUTSAjBpFLpYAsqQdGtJRmCu5